8255控制字怎么算出来的

作者&投稿:奚郝 (若有异议请与网页底部的电邮联系)

在数字信道中传送数字信号时为什么要编码?
为了接收端识别啊,把0和1按一定的规律传送出去,若是不编码就是乱七八糟的数字信号,接收端就没办法译码了,就像一个电报机,每个字都是编码的,若是不编收报机怎么知道接受的是什么呢。

计算机中为什么要采用校验码?常用的校验码有哪几种?用在什么地方_百度...
ASCII码就是用0~255这256个数来为我们通常所用的数字、字母,运算、逻辑等各种符号编码,作为在计算机中的表现形式。 ASCII码:美国(国家)资讯交换标准(代)码,一种使用7个或8个二进位制位进行编码的方案,最多可以给256个字元(包括字母、数字、标点符号、控制字元及其他符号)分配(或指定)数值。...

如何区分国标码和汉字信息交换码?
控制字符 00000000~00100000、01111111 0~32、127 可用汉字段 00100001~01111110 33~126 (1~94)扩充 ASCII 码 10000000~11111111 128~255 控制字符 10000000~10100000、11111111 128~160、255 GB2312-80 10100001~11111110 161~254 (1~94)此标准的汉字编码表有9...

文件名长度-文件名长度,文件名,长度
1、文件名长度最大为255字符(其中包括文件扩展名)。2、文件的全路径名长度最大为260字符。基于以上两点,文件名并非只要小于255字符就可,还要受其所在路径深度的制约。 文件名的长度字符怎么算 “文件A1”,如果A和1不是全角的话,那么这个文件名字占6个字符。 另外,如果有扩展名的,也要把扩展名算进去。追问: 文...

ASCII码表里的字符总共有多少个?
ASCII码使用指定的7位或8位二进制数组合来表示128或256种可能的字符。标准ASCII码也叫基础ASCII码,使用7位二进制数来表示所有的大写和小写字母,数字0到9、标点符号,以及在美式英语中使用的特殊控制字符。其中:0~31及127(共33个)是控制字符或通信专用字符(其余为可显示字符),如控制符:LF(换行...

ASCII码只能是数字吗?0到255之间的整数吗?
码,简称ASCII码。ASCII码共有128个元素,其中包括32个通用控制字符、10个十进制数码、52个英文大写小写字母和34个专用符号。除了阿拉伯数字,大小写英文字母,还有通用控制字符、专用符号,别的没有了。标准的ASCII码是0~127(即128个)(7位)。扩展的ASCII码是0~255(即256个)(8位)...

129的ascii码等于多少?怎么算的?
“129”的ascii码对应的是:0x31、0x32、0x39。ascii码共定义了128个字符,其中:字符1对应的码值是00110001(二进制),061(八进制),49(十进制),0x31(十六进制)。字符2对应的码值是00110010(二进制),062(八进制),50(十进制),0x32(十六进制)。字符9对应的码值是0011 1001(二...

微型计算机的字长是怎么变化的
默认的一个字节的长度为8位二进制 ,一个字的长度为16字节,这与规定有关,ASCII 码地有效表示是0~255,表示所有的控制字符和数字和字符,都是可以用一个字节表示的,即八位二进制。在其他指标相同时,字长越大计算机的处理数据的速度就越快。早期的微机字长一般是8位和16位,386以及更高的处理器...

计算机中,“字”是什么意思?
一串数码作为一个整体来处理或运算的,称为一个计算机字,简称字。字通常分为若干个字节(每个字节一般是8位)。在存储器中,通常每个单元存储一个字,因此每个字都是可以寻址的。字的长度用位数来表示。在计算机的运算器、控制器中,通常都是以字为单位进行传送的。字出现在不同的地址其含义是不相同。

ASCii码值最大的是
2、 ASCII 码使用指定的7 位或8 位二进制数组合来表示128 或256 种可能的字符。3、0~31及127(共33个)是控制字符或通信专用字符(其余为可显示字符),如控制符:LF(换行)、CR(回车)、FF(换页)、DEL(删除)、BS(退格)、BEL(响铃)等;通信专用字符:SOH(文头)、EOT(文尾)、ACK...

祝满15521347471问: 8255A怎么求控制字 怎么看是哪种方式 C口怎么看这个题为例 具体讲讲 -
合作市安体回答:[答案] 从图中看出,8255的A口作输入口(由K1~K8开关的断/通,控制A口电平高/低);8255的B口作输出口(控制8组LED的亮/灭);8255的C口无任何线路或元件连接(闲置);由此,可定义方式控制字为90H,或91H,或98H,或99H.这4个...

祝满15521347471问: 8255A怎么求控制字 怎么看是哪种方式 C口怎么看 -
合作市安体回答: 解答:从图中看出, 8255的A口作输入口(由K1~K8开关的断/通,控制A口电平高/低); 8255的B口作输出口(控制8组LED的亮/灭); 8255的C口无任何线路或元件连接(闲置);由此,可定义方式控制字为90H,或91H,或98H,或99H. 这4个方式控制字都能控制A口作输入口、B口作输出口, 工作方式都是0(基本的I/O方式);之所以方式控制字可有4种选择,是因为硬件设计是 C口闲置(高4位/低4位,输入/输出,共4种组合之任一种选择,对A口、B口都无影响).

祝满15521347471问: 8255,怎么通过控制方式写控制字 -
合作市安体回答: 控制字为 b0h,即 1011 0000b 口a方式1输入,b口方式0输出.

祝满15521347471问: 请写出8255方式控制字的字格式,若要使8255的PA口为方式0输入,PB口为方式1输出,PC4~PC7为输出,PC0~PC3为输 -
合作市安体回答: 先确定控制字:A口方式0输出,B口方式0输出即 控制字为:10000000B=80H 下面是程序:(我们假设地址为40H-43H) MOV DX,43H MOV AL,80H OUT DX,AL MOV DI,OFFSET BUF-DATA MOV CL,09H DISI:MOV BL,[DI+0] PUSH BX POP ...

祝满15521347471问: 8255的初始化程序是什么 -
合作市安体回答: 1、地址确定 因为A10A9A8A7A6A5A4A3=01010011,A2A1=11为控制字端口,A2A1=10为C口,A2A1=01为B口,A2A1=00为A口,A0为0,所以8255A地址范围为24CH~24FH. 2、控制字确定 因为A口为方式0输出,B口为方式0输入,所以...

祝满15521347471问: 8255的方式选择控制字应写入什么??? -
合作市安体回答: 举例说明如下:.8255_A口,B口,C口,控制口地址依次为40H,41H,42H,43H A口作方式0输出,B口作方式0输入,C口闲置方式控制字 = 1000 0010b8255 初始化程序如下:MOV AL, 10000010b...

祝满15521347471问: 8255芯片的初始化编程 -
合作市安体回答: 8255的工作方式如下 A方式0、输入,B方式1、输出,C7-4输出, C3-0输入 控制字为95H,初始化程序: MOV AL,95H OUT port,AL

祝满15521347471问: 你好 请问下8255 的端口地址 和控制字地址怎么设置?怎么从硬件上查看出来? 谢谢 -
合作市安体回答: 8255的扩展端口地址不是唯一的,在0000H~FFFFH,除了cs,A0,A1这三个位固定外,其他可以任意,如cs占用p2.7,A1占用P0.1,A0占用P0.0,那么可用的端口地址是:A口:(cs=P2.7=0,A1A0=P0.1P0.0=00)0000H~7FFCHB口:(cs=P2.7=0,A1A0=P0.1P0.0=01)0001H~7FFDHC口:(cs=P2.7=0,A1A0=P0.1P0.0=10)0002H~7FFEH控制口:(cs=P2.7=0,A1A0=P0.1P0.0=11)0003H~7FFFH,通常可选择其中的最高地址作为这个芯片的地址来写程序

祝满15521347471问: 写8255控制字时,需要将A1A0置为? -
合作市安体回答: 在对8255写数据之前先对端口进行配置,比如配置PA口为输入,PB为输出.这些都是由控制寄存器的控制字决定的.而要写控制寄存器,首先就需要通过A1A0寻址到它.即先寻址控制寄存器进行配置,然后再读写PA,PB,PC端口,他们没有冲突.

祝满15521347471问: 如果将8255的A口设置为方式1输出,B口设置为方式1输入,对应的控制号是多少 -
合作市安体回答: A口方式1输出,B口方式1输入,方式控制字为:10100110b, 即A6h


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网